  • Tips to add a VPN router to my current network configuration

    Dear all

    My apologies if the answer to this question already exists, however, I searched in many situations and none seem to match what I'm after.

    I currently have an ISP modem/router in Bridge mode connected to a TC of Apple which is my wireless router, I have 2 Express airport connected to this acting as the extensors of the range.  I have a VPN service through the MyPrivate network I activate on the desired device when required and everything works fine.

    What I want to do now is to be able to use my AppleTV and burning Amazon via the VPN as well so you need to add a VPN router in the configuration.  I want to finish with 2 wireless networks running together for these devices who need VPN and those who are not.  I don't want to lose the opportunity to extend the network to express it however airport.

    If someone could explain to me if this is possible and if so how do I set up the network.

    Thanks in advance

    Mark

    Basically you would need a device that supports VPN-passthrough and VLANS for your goals of networking. MyPrivate network, seems to be a VPN SSL, which is a user-server configuration. In other words, you install a client VPN on your Mac and you connect to the VPN network MyPrivate server to establish a VPN tunnel.

    Networking two or more "separated", should be using a router that supports VLAN services. Each segment of VIRTUAL local area network, in essence, would be a separate, she either wired or wireless network or a combination of both. This would probably be the 'easiest' part for the installation program.

    Now how combining the two would be the question, and I don't know what would be the best way, or even if it is possible.

    A few thoughts:

    • Use a router that supports VLANS. Create at least two VIRTUAL LAN segments. One for Apple TV & Burns, one for Internet access in general. Connect the device to VPN client host on the first segment, and configure for Internet sharing.
    • Download a dedicated VPN network application that supports hosting of third-party VPN clients, like yours. You would still need a router that supports VLAN to provided separate network segments.
    • Hire a consultant network. Let them know what you the goals of networking and ask them to offer potential solutions.

  • Use the second router to extend the network to Time Capsule

    I have a v7.6.7 running Time Capsule 1 TB and older airport. I'm hoping to add a second router in a new location, and I use an ethernet cable from the TC at the new router (TP Link Archer C5), updated to the latest version of the firmware. The IP address of the TC is 192.168.1.1.

    I have set up my router C5 as follows: allocation of IP 192.168.1.199, value DHCP = off, and I connect a cable between the TC ports and port WAN (not Internet) available on the C5. In the C5 wireless settings, I tried both using the TC SSID and pw and creating a new SSID and pw. In both cases, the network will work for a short time, but eventually the entire network, including the TC, stops working. I made no changes to the parameters of the TC on any trial.

    Is it possible to use a TC and a router not Apple on the same network? If so, what are the right settings for the TC and the secondary router? If not, is it better to have the not Apple as main router and add the TC to the network created by the non-Apple router?

    Is it possible to use a TC and a router not Apple on the same network? If so, what are the right settings for the TC and the secondary router?

    Yes. That would be the basis of a network of mobile type.

    The key for a roaming network parameters are:

    • The 'primary' router must be configured as a router. In other words, it must have active NAT and DHCP services.
    • All other routers used in a network of roaming must be reconfigured as a bridge.
    • All routers must broadcast a Wi - Fi network that uses the same network (SSID, aka) name, and the type of wireless security, and the password.
    • All routers must be interconnected by Ethernet. To provide Powerline adapters using an Ethernet connectivity should also work.

    If not, is it better to have the not Apple as main router and add the TC to the network created by the non-Apple router?

    Should not really which is the main in the roaming network.

    I think at this point, your current circuit line. To check that, I would suggest that you consider to bring back the router C5 in the same room as you have the TC. Then connect it directly to one of the LAN of the TC ports. Complete the entire upward to a mobile network and test it. If everything works, bring back the C5 in the desired location, and then try again.

    If it fails, then the circuit line will be tested to check that it provides a solid 'Ethernet' connection between the adapters.
